Avidex, a privately owned company headquartered in the US, founded in 2003, employs approximately 270 individuals, and reported $161.0M in revenue as of 2025. The company specializes in providing Pro AV services, functioning as a Pro AV systems integrator.

News Summary:

On February 23, 2026, Avidex published insights on the evolving role of audiovisual (AV) technology within healthcare, detailing how patient room technology is shifting from point solutions to integrated ecosystems driven by changing patient expectations and care delivery models. Another piece highlighted AV technology's increasing inclusion in broader healthcare IT strategies, where it supports clinical workflows, staff collaboration, patient engagement, and facility-wide communication, extending beyond traditional focuses like Electronic Medical Records and cybersecurity. Earlier, on February 2, Avidex announced its 2026 Technology Showcase & Conference, scheduled for March 26 in Nashua, NH, bringing together over 40 AV manufacturers for demonstrations and discussions. This followed Avidex CEO Jeff Davis's Executive Q&A in the February issue of SCN on January 29, where he discussed recent acquisitions, the future of the AV industry, and the company's long-term vision. Previously, on January 13, Jeff Davis was named President of the 2026 PSNI Global Alliance Board, a global network of certified audiovisual and technology solution providers.
